环境监测对于抗击流行病的价值

概括
环境采样监测 (ESS) 提供了早期的流行病警告,可能挽救生命并降低成本. 扩大ESS是有价值的,特别是对于更致命的病原体,即使在罕见的疫情中也提供了净收益.

背景情况:
- 环境采样监测 (ESS) 技术,如废水基因组监测和空气传感器在COVID-19大流行期间获得了吸引力.
- 欧洲社会统计系统为公共卫生应对提供了关键数据,但其覆盖范围不一致.
- 决策者需要指导如何扩大和维持ESS的努力.
研究的目的:
- 引入一个模型来量化ESS系统在疫情应对中的价值.
- 以COVID-19作为基准来评估ESS的经济和公共卫生效益.
- 探索ESS值如何受到病原体特征和干预有效性的影响.
主要方法:
- 开发了一个模型来量化ESS系统的价值,提供领先的流行病学指标.
- 在第一年模拟了一种类似于COVID-19的流行病情景.
- 分析了生物和社会参数对ESS价值的影响.
主要成果:
- 具有5天早期预警优势的ESS系统可以将死亡人数减少10%,并在COVID-19类流行病的第一年每人获得1,450美元的净货币收益.
- 随着病原体的传染性和期限,ESS的价值会增加,这取决于有效的公共卫生干预措施.
- 对于不经常出现的病原体,ESS系统即使在长期维持的情况下也显示出净积极的益处.
结论:
- 在疫情防控和应对方面,ESS系统为公共卫生和经济提供了重要的价值.
- 这些发现支持ESS覆盖范围的战略扩展和扩展,以最大限度地提高收益.
- 通过ESS,可以确定病原体的优先级,并为监测系统分配资源.
